Copy number variation in the carboxylesterase 1 gene and the risk of non-alcoholic fatty liver in a Chinese Han population-a case control study
2020-02-25
Abstract excerpt
<title>Abstract</title> <p>Background: A recent genome-wide copy number variations (CNVs) scan identified a 16q12.2 deletion that included the carboxylesterase 1 (CES1) gene, which is important in the metabolism of fatty acids and cholesterol. We aimed to investigate whether CES1 CNVs was associated with susceptibility to non-alc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D) in a Chinese Han population. <h4>Methods:</h4> A c...
